What to Review Before Signing or Negotiating
Before moving forward with any funding agreement, request and examine the full contract package, including schedules, repayment terms, and any addenda. Pay special attention to how “repayment” is triggered, how amounts are calculated, and how long repayment can last based on payment streams. If your agreement references daily deposits, factor rates, or other formulas, make sure you understand the total cost under realistic revenue scenarios.
It also helps to document your business circumstances and payment history. If you are already in repayment and facing escalating demands, gather statements, correspondence, and proof of attempted compliance. This record supports legal assessment and can guide the best next steps, whether that involves negotiating a settlement, seeking a modification, or challenging improper collection practices.
